Frailin Guanipa is a Venezuelan pool player .

Career

In September 2009 Frailin Guanipa reached the final in the 10-ball at the Pan American Championships and was defeated there by the Mexican Ignacio Chavez . A year later he lost the 8-ball final against his compatriot Jalal Yousef and won the bronze medal in 9-ball . At the Pan American Championships in 2013 he made it into the final in 9-ball, which he lost again to Yousef. In June 2014 Guanipa took part in the 9-ball world championship for the first time and was eliminated in the preliminary round. At the Pan American Championships in 2016 he reached the final in the disciplines 8-ball and 9-ball and lost there to Alejandro Carvajal and Jorge Llanos, respectively .
